What is Make Peace With The Donkey?


1.

PHRASE:

To accept one's fate. To give in to the inevitable.

From an old saying of unknown origin.

"Fate is a stubborn mule; sometimes you've got to give in and make peace with the donkey."

"Joe decided to make peace with the donkey and accept his punishment like a man."

"There's no point in living in the past. Make peace with the donkey and get on with your life."
